The Whitsundays are a combination of 74 islands on the bottom half of the Great Barrier Reef with stunning views and beautiful aquatic life. Which makes it very popular for amongst every kind of traveler. Arlie beach is the departure town for all the Whitsunday boats and they’re is a boat for every kind of traveler. The Atlantic clipper is known as the party boat of the Whitsunday's which is why I picked it. It holds 52 people + crew but at no time do you ever feel that their are too many people on the boat or that it is too small. Most rooms house 3 people, there is a hot tub and a diving board and a slide on the boat. The boat has everything you need from really good food to snorkeling gear, the only thing they don’t supply is the booz so when you go on the 2 day 2 night trip you need to make sure you have enough, like I said it is a party boat.

As the Atlantic Clipper started to leave Arlie beach everyone had put there belongings in the rooms I was rooming with two other girls. This was my first time sleeping on a boat so I was unsure how I would go but it is a fairly large boat so I didn’t have much trouble at all. Everyone was relaxing on the boat deck and taking in the beautiful views as we left the harbor.

That night we all played drinking games of every kind, card games, never have I ever, thumbs and the list goes on. In the morning we made our way to Whitehaven beach one of Australia's iconic photos, it was a bit of an over cast day but we made the most of it went for a swim and relaxed. after that we went to another anchoring spot and went snorkeling on the bottom half of the Great Barrier Reef there is also a celebrity at this spot “Elvis” a giant fish that loves the tourists. After another great meal, that night the crew got everyone dress up using a box of crazy outfits and to play games just really funny/embarrassing but everyone is doing it and laughing good times. And of cores with the mood set more drinking commenced that night as well.

We woke up early the next day do do some more snorkeling and play on the slide again. Sadly this was the day our party boat ended and we made out way back to Arlie Beach. It was not a smooth ride the waves got pretty big to the point that the front of the boat was going under the waves so most of us stayed top side so we wouldn't get sea sick. Even the rough weather couldn't damper our spirits of the fun we had.
